EICMA 2025: Royal Enfield Flying Flea S6 EV Brings Retro Spirit to the Electric Era
At EICMA 2025 in Milan, Royal Enfield took a bold step into the future while honouring its rich past. The brand’s electric arm, Flying Flea, revealed its latest creation, the Flying Flea S6 EV, a scrambler-style electric motorcycle that channels the spirit of the original Flying Flea bikes from the 1940s. With its lightweight frame, off-road character, and modern electric powertrain, the Flying Flea S6 represents a seamless blend of heritage and innovation.
A Modern Rebirth of a Classic Name
The original Royal Enfield Flying Flea was designed as a wartime lightweight motorcycle, famously dropped from planes for quick troop mobility. The new Flying Flea S6 draws from that history of agility and adaptability but reinterprets it for modern riders. Minimalistic yet muscular, it features 19-inch front and 18-inch rear wheels, upside-down forks, and fin-inspired elements that merge into a sleek central spine. The design evokes nostalgia while setting the tone for Royal Enfield’s new EV identity.

Design and Technology
True to its retro modern theme, the Flying Flea S6 blends classic craftsmanship with cutting-edge technology. The finned magnesium battery casing keeps weight in check while aiding cooling efficiency. Up front, a round touchscreen TFT cluster pays homage to the classic Flea’s simple gauge, now reimagined as a high-resolution display offering navigation, connectivity, and system data.
Underneath the design is a connected tech ecosystem powered by a Qualcomm Snapdragon QWM2290 processor, enabling 4G, Wi Fi, and Bluetooth functionality. The system supports voice commands for navigation and media while allowing OTA updates. Multi-device connectivity means riders can pair their smartphones and smartwatches for real-time control, ride modes, and diagnostics.
Power and Performance
The Royal Enfield Flying Flea S6 EV is built for versatility, offering a confident ride both on tarmac and light trails. Its high-torque electric motor and long-travel suspension deliver instant power with stability. Switchable dual-channel ABS, lean angle traction control, and a dedicated off-road mode make it one of the most capable electric scramblers in its class. Intelligent Connectivity and Innovation
Royal Enfield has invested heavily in digital integration for the Flying Flea lineup. The use of Qualcomm and NXP microcontrollers ensures secure communication and efficient energy management. This architecture allows over-the-air updates, continuous performance tuning, and improved data handling, features once reserved for high-end electric motorcycles.
Launch Plans and Market Impact

The Flying Flea S6 is set to debut in India and international markets by the end of 2026. It will be Royal Enfield’s second production EV, following the FF.C6. With brands like Hero MotoCorp and TVS preparing new electric models, the Flying Flea S6 positions Royal Enfield as a serious player in the emerging electric motorcycle market.
